C语言中的term是什么意思啊?

如题所述

C语言中的 term 不是系统的保留字,它是用户自定义标识符。
因为是自定义标识符,那么可以是任何意思,看该用户自己是怎么规定的。

从英语词义来看,term 可以表示 “项”,例如数列:
y = 1/(2*3) + 2/(3*4) + 3/(4*5) + 4/(5*6) + ...n/( (n+1) * (n+2) ) + ...
求,前20项之和。

double term, sum=0; // term 是项,sum 是累加器,存放总和。

int i;
for (i=1;i<=20;i++){
term = i / (double)((i+1)*(i+2)); //第 i 项的 (浮点四则运算)计算
sum = sum + term; //累加此项
};
printf("sum=%f\n", sum); //输出总和
温馨提示:答案为网友推荐,仅供参考